#e1a653 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e1a653 is composed of 88.2% red, 65.1%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.2% magenta, 63.1%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 35.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 60.4%. #e1a653 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a6 with #c34d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#e1a653 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e1a653 has RGB values of R:225, G:166,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.63,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14788179.

Shades and Tints of #e1a653

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0802 is the darkest color, while #fefc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e1a653

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9a99 is the less saturated color, while #f8aa3c is the most saturated one.
